Transaction 584283f62a4f14da98b17125155d742c7f8835c8c818010c041c8f2cc015aed8

3 Input
2 Outputs
  • 584283f62a4f14da98b17125155d742c7f8835c8c818010c041c8f2cc015aed8:0
  • value  252667
    address  1KKLzsH46Z8GeKcWU5wpw9uUP5EVcirX9g
  • 584283f62a4f14da98b17125155d742c7f8835c8c818010c041c8f2cc015aed8:1
  • value  3832475
    address  1GeSDjd2DRpxjy53FNsV4nWzUBtcZZoLXV